Giesecke+Devrient (GD) specializes in securing mobile connections, legal identities, and digital infrastructures. When it comes to digital security, we serve as the trusted partner for governments, public authorities, and enterprises globally. We safeguard and manage confidential systems, networks, data, and identities in physical, digital and mobile environments.

About the Role

This role is ideal for someone who combines strong technical expertise with excellent communication skills and enjoys driving continuous improvement across processes, tools, and ways of working. You will work closely with development teams, product owners, security stakeholders, and other technical teams to ensure reliable, scalable, and efficient solutions in Azure.

 

Key responsibilities

  • Design, deploy, and maintain software services and cloud-native solutions in Microsoft Azure
  • Develop and optimize CI/CD pipelines to enable efficient and reliable software delivery
  • Automate infrastructure, operational processes, and deployment workflows
  • Manage and support containerized environments and cloud infrastructure
  • Implement and maintain monitoring, logging, and observability solutions
  • Collaborate closely with development teams throughout the application lifecycle
  • Act as a trusted technical advisor and help guide the team through complex challenges
  • Translate technical concepts into clear and understandable business language for stakeholders, product owners, and other teams

Technical skills:

  • Strong hands-on experience with Microsoft Azure
  • Experience deploying, building, and managing software services in Azure environments
  • Solid understanding of CI/CD pipelines and DevOps best practices
  • Experience with Docker and containerized applications
  • Strong focus on automation and infrastructure management
  • Experience with Terraform and/or Ansible
  • Understanding of the Java application lifecycle and related deployment processes
  • Interest in, and practical use of, AI-powered tools to improve productivity, automation, and engineering workflows
